Japan's national parks are launching multi-day trekking programs to drive tourism revenue to rural communities while promoting sustainable outdoor recreation.

3 Key Points

  1. Japanese national parks are developing multiday hiking routes through remote rural areas to attract trekking tourists

  2. The initiative aims to create economic benefits for local communities in less-visited regions

  3. Trekking tourism is positioned as a way to balance visitor experiences with community development

  4. The strategy encourages tourists to explore Japan's natural landscapes beyond major urban centers
